The Metropolitan Opera- Eugene Onegin
Following her acclaimed 2024 company debut in Puccini’s Madama Butterfly, soprano Asmik
Grigorian returns to the Met as Tatiana, the lovestruck young heroine in this ardent operatic
adaptation of Pushkin. Baritone Igor Golovatenko reprises his portrayal of the urbane Onegin, who
realizes his affection for her all too late. The Met’s evocative production, directed by Tony Award–
winner Deborah Warner, “offers a beautifully detailed reading of … Tchaikovsky’s lyrical romance”
(The Telegraph).
Sung in Russian with English subtitles.

For 60 years, Queen Elizabeth II met with each of her 12 prime ministers in a private weekly meeting. This meeting is known as The Audience. EPiC: Elvis Presley in Concert is a 2025 documentary-concert film directed by Baz Luhrmann, featuring newly discovered, restored footage from the 1970s Las Vegas residencies . Narrated by Elvis himself through newly uncovered audio, the film blends, high-energy live performances with intimate backstage moments, bypassing traditional talking-head interviews to showcase the man and artist.
